Hey Obtuse and thanks for the concern. "Vibe" coding is really just using the new coding tools available. Every programmer on the planet does it, just as they ALL use Stackoverflow.

It is a good point that during a educational program like this, I would not be relying or really using "vibe" coding. You really need to get your own hands dirty to understand how to code (as its a certain way of thinking).

It also gets in the way of learning the problem solving skill needed and developing the debugging intuition (something you REALLY need if you rely on GenAI code generation as often it doesn't work right out of the box).

Anything I would show would just be a one off on what the tools are and how to use them. I did the same with all my staff upskilling as it can really help people who have established the basics.

Custom ChatGPT for retrieving your company's financial data by herpaway_account in FPandA

[–]high_ticket 0 points1 point  (0 children)

Make sure any model you use is housed within your company's IT environment or a specific service they use like Amazon Benchmark. Otherwise you are providing your company's information to OpenAI or whatever company is hosting the model.

Depends on your set up, but a Return Augmented Generation (RAG) model would work. This set up combines the prompt you give it (the date and type of info) and looks at a vectorized database (your company's data) and then feeds the info to the generalized LLM model. Cheaper and easier than a fine tuning a model.
